What's the best solution for drainage problems with Foster City's high water table?

Tidal inundation risk in saline-sodic clay soils requires engineered drainage. Permeable interlocking concrete pavers allow 80-95% water infiltration, reducing surface runoff. Subsurface French drains with gravel beds direct water away from foundations. The Foster City Planning and Building Division requires these systems to meet BASMAA stormwater standards, preventing neighborhood flooding.

What invasive species threaten Foster City gardens, and how do I remove them safely?

Watch for yellow starthistle, French broom, and iceplant that outcompete natives. Manual removal before seed set prevents spread without chemicals. For persistent infestations, targeted spot treatments using BASMAA-compliant herbicides avoid runoff violations. Apply only during dry periods to prevent stormwater contamination, and never during blackout dates specified in local ordinances.

Should I replace my lawn with native plants to reduce maintenance costs?

Transitioning to California Poppy, Coast Live Oak, Sticky Monkeyflower, and Salvia apiana reduces water use 60-80% and eliminates weekly mowing. These natives thrive in Zone 10a without synthetic inputs. Electric maintenance equipment operates quietly within 8:00 AM-6:00 PM noise ordinances, avoiding gas-blower restrictions. This approach future-proofs landscapes against tightening water and noise regulations.

Are permeable pavers better than wood decking for Foster City patios?

Permeable interlocking concrete pavers last 25+ years versus wood's 10-15 years in saline conditions. They create defensible space matching Foster City's low fire-wise rating by eliminating combustible materials. Unlike wood, pavers resist rot from high groundwater and require no chemical treatments. Their permeability also reduces runoff, meeting stricter 2026 stormwater management standards.

How do I keep my Tall Fescue healthy under Foster City's water restrictions?

Stage 1 voluntary conservation requires precise water management. Wi-Fi ET-based weather sensing irrigation calculates evapotranspiration rates, delivering exactly what dwarf Tall Fescue cultivars need—typically 0.75-1 inch weekly. This technology reduces water use 20-30% while maintaining turf health. Programming adjustments for microclimates prevent overwatering and comply with municipal limits.

What permits and licenses are needed for grading my 0.12-acre Foster City lot?

The Foster City Planning and Building Division requires grading permits for any excavation exceeding 2 cubic yards. Contractors must hold CSLB licenses with A (General Engineering) or C-27 (Landscaping) classifications for earthmoving work. On 0.12-acre lots, improper grading can trigger drainage violations and neighbor disputes. Licensed professionals ensure compliance with setback requirements and soil stability standards.

Why does my Foster City soil feel so dense and salty, and what can I do about it?

Edgewater Isle lots have saline-sodic clay soil with pH 7.5-8.2, a legacy of 50 years of development since 1976. This soil maturity means compaction has reduced permeability, limiting root growth and water infiltration. Core aeration every 2-3 years with organic amendments like composted bark improves soil structure and reduces salinity. Regular soil testing monitors pH adjustments for optimal plant health.
